    Where can I eat the food that's grown on the land ride? Which restaurants are they in?

    Some of the produce which is grown inside the greenhouses on the Living With The Land attraction in Epcot's The Land Pavilion can be found in The Garden Grill Restaurant, Sunshine Seasons food court and even over at the neighbouring Coral Reef Restaurant as well as many other restaurants around 'The World' from time to time. Exactly which restaurants are able to use which produce types does change based on availability and current crops being grown or harvested.

    If you should choose to dine at The Garden Grill during your next stay at Walt Disney World, ask your server to ask the Chef which items on the menu that day are using the sustainable produce or fish from the greenhouses. That way you can order one of those specific items from the menu if you wish and you'll know exactly how it was grown and where it came from!
